They are a shadowy component of the UFO phenomena, they appear after a sighting to silent witnesses and warn them away but who are the men in black and where did they come from?
In 1947 In the earliest days of the modern UFO era Ray Palmer would write an account of and UFO crash near Maury Island, following this crash the witness would claim he was harassed by a  man dressed all in black who told him never to speak of the incident again.  Later the witnesses would claim the incident was a hoax and never talk about it again.
In 1952 Enthusiast and Researcher  Albert K Bender would found the world’s first UFO CLUB the IBFS and publish a successful quarterly newsletter for its  members. Shortly after founding the Bureau Bender began to run into various problems and a year later in 1953 he shut down the IFSB after being visited by three strange men in black suits who told him to leave the topic alone and to stop publishing his newsletter.  Gray Barker one of the IFSB members would record Benders incident in his 1956 his book They knew to Much About Flying saucers to paint a story about mysterious government shadow men dressed  in black who had harassed Bender.  These entities would come to be called the Men In Black.
Several years later in 1962 Bender would write his own book Flying saucers the 3 men in which he  revealed the reason he had disbanded the IFSB. He claimed the that the MIB were of extraterrestrial origin and that they had their own agenda, a 15 year mission, they had warned Bender not to speak until after their mission was completed and they had left, which he did.
